[0055] figure 1 A flowchart 100 is shown illustrating an exemplary embodiment of a method of using a CT system to define scan parameters for a CT scan of a region of interest of an examination subject. In step 1.I, image capture BA of the patient is initially performed using a camera. The camera is arranged relative to the examination object (in this case the patient) such that at least a segment of the patient covering a desired field of view FoV can be recorded. exist figure 1 In the exemplary embodiment shown, the camera used is a 3D camera that acquires a 3D profile of the patient. In step 1.II, based on the captured image BA, CT reference image data BD that matches the captured image BA as closely as possible is obtained from the database ref. For example, the size of the body region recorded on the captured image BA must be the same as the reference image data BD ref The corresponding size matches. Abstract

A method for defining scan parameters of a CT scan (CT‑SC) of a region of interest (FoV) of an examination object (O) using a CT system (1) is described. For this method, an external image capture (BA) of the external features of the examination object (O) is performed using an additional image capture unit (K). Additionally, at least one scan parameter in the axial direction of the CT system is determined based on the external image acquisition (BA). Finally, a CT scan (CT-SC) is performed using the determined at least one scan parameter. Additionally, a CT scan range limiting device (30) is described. A computed tomography system (1) is also described.

technical field [0001] The present invention relates to a method for defining scanning parameters of a CT scan of a region of interest of an examination object using a CT system. The invention also relates to a CT scanning parameter defining device. The invention finally relates to a computer tomography system. Background technique [0002] With modern imaging methods, two-dimensional or three-dimensional image data are often generated, which can be used to visualize the examination object, but also for other applications. [0003] Imaging methods are generally based on the detection of X-radiation, wherein so-called projection measurement data are generated. The projection measurement data may be acquired, for example, using a computed tomography system (CT system).
